Update: Shoe Fire is at 3,760 Acres As Fire Risk Increases
The Watch Duty app reported at 1:30 pm today, October 15, that the Shoe Fire is now at 3,760 acres and still holding at 7% containment. According to the United States Forest Service, as of this morning the fire was pushing to the southeast.

UPDATE: The Shoe Fire burning in steep terrain behind Lake Shasta reaches 300 acres
The Shoe Fire, burning northeast of Lake Shasta, continued to spread Wednesday night. By late afternoon it had reached 300 acres, with no containment. Shasta County sheriff's officials have ordered evacuations in the area of the fire, which is burning off Fender's Ferry road northeast of the lake.
